At the factory where he works, Mr. Lopez must make a minimum of 48 circuit boards per day. On Wednesday, he made 60 circuit boards. What percent of the required minimum did he make?
  • A. 125%
  • B. 112%
  • C. 80%
  • D. 25%
Correct Answer & Rationale
Correct Answer: A

To find the percentage of the required minimum that Mr. Lopez made, divide the number of circuit boards he produced (60) by the minimum required (48) and then multiply by 100. \[ \text{Percentage} = \left(\frac{60}{48}\right) \times 100 = 125\% \] Option A is correct as it reflects that he made 125% of the minimum requirement. Option B (112%) is incorrect because it underestimates his production relative to the minimum. Option C (80%) is also wrong, as it suggests he produced only a fraction of the required amount. Option D (25%) is far too low, indicating a misunderstanding of the basic calculation.

Marisol has 5 times as many books as Jerry. Jerry has 15 books. How many books does Marisol have?
  • A. 10
  • B. 20
  • C. 75
  • D. 225
Correct Answer & Rationale
Correct Answer: C

To determine how many books Marisol has, multiply the number of books Jerry has (15) by 5, since Marisol has 5 times as many. This calculation yields 15 x 5 = 75. Option A (10) is incorrect as it underestimates the multiplication factor. Option B (20) also miscalculates, suggesting a much lower total. Option D (225) overestimates the number of books, resulting from an incorrect multiplication. Thus, the only accurate answer is 75, reflecting Marisol's total based on Jerry's count.
Which of the following is equivalent to 1.04?
  • A. 52/51
  • B. 51/50
  • C. 27/25
  • D. 26/25
Correct Answer & Rationale
Correct Answer: D

To determine which option is equivalent to 1.04, we convert each fraction to a decimal. A: 52/51 equals approximately 1.0196, which is less than 1.04. B: 51/50 equals 1.02, also below 1.04. C: 27/25 equals 1.08, exceeding 1.04. D: 26/25 calculates to 1.04 exactly, matching the target value. Thus, option D accurately represents 1.04, while the other options do not meet the requirement.
If 32% of n is 20.8, what is n?
  • A. 64
  • B. 65
  • C. 66
  • D. 154
Correct Answer & Rationale
Correct Answer: B

To find n, we start with the equation derived from the problem: \(0.32n = 20.8\). Dividing both sides by 0.32 gives \(n = \frac{20.8}{0.32}\), which simplifies to 65. This confirms that option B is accurate. Option A (64) results from an incorrect calculation of \(0.32n\). Option C (66) overestimates n, suggesting a misunderstanding of the percentage relationship. Option D (154) is far too high, indicating a significant miscalculation. Thus, only option B aligns correctly with the mathematical solution.
0.4/0.04 =
  • A. 100
  • B. 10
  • C. 0.1
  • D. 0.01
Correct Answer & Rationale
Correct Answer: B

To solve 0.4 divided by 0.04, it’s helpful to convert both numbers to whole numbers for easier calculation. Multiplying both by 100 gives us 40 divided by 4. This simplifies to 10, confirming option B as the solution. Option A (100) results from miscalculating the division, possibly by incorrectly interpreting the decimal places. Option C (0.1) and Option D (0.01) suggest a misunderstanding of division, as they reflect values far smaller than the actual quotient. Thus, only option B accurately represents the result of the division.
